# Artifact Signing — Timezone Handling in Report Exports

If you're writing a plugin for Hollowgate's report exporter, a friendly warning: export timestamps are always UTC internally, and the signing step hashes the raw UTC payload — not the localized view. So don't mutate timestamps before the sign hook fires, or verification will fail downstream even though the file looks fine. Localize in the render layer instead. All plugin-produced exports must be signed with the shared exporter identity so the portal accepts them; that key follows below.

signing key of bagap-yawep = bky13_TbfT6ZMUoGJo2

Ticket: Crashfall ingest failing on staging

New folks, please read carefully. The Pebblekit mobile app's crash reports aren't reaching the symbolication queue because staging's env file was copied without its upload credential. Symptoms: 401s in the collector logs every five minutes. To fix, add the missing line to the env file, exactly as follows.

secret setting of fafop-tagep: VAULT_KEY29=6a815d21e2d77cc25ef1802d73ee6

TURN-208: Gatevale turnstile counters at the Merrow Field pilot double-count when a rotation reverses mid-cycle. Attendance totals drift roughly 2% high per event. The debounce window fix is implemented, reviewed by Ilsa, and soak-tested across two simulated match days without drift. Ready for your cut; the candidate build is identified below.

trace token, tagag-tafog: htk6_5ed18c

This page summarizes the board-level decision regarding the Larkspur plant. After reviewing demand forecasts for the Novadene product family, management recommends expanding Line 3 rather than commissioning a second shift at the Eastbrae facility. The expansion adds roughly 18% throughput at lower fixed cost, with an estimated fourteen-month payback. Eastbrae remains a contingency site. Tooling orders will be staged to preserve optionality. The confidential planning note below records the board's underlying intent:

internal memo for faweg-tafog: Only 7 of the 100 pilot accounts renewed Quenael, so a churn review is set for April 15.